AP tops ease of doing rankings again

National News, News

New Delhi: Andhra Pradesh topped the list of states in the ease of doing business rankings 2019 followed by Uttar Pradesh and Telangana, showed in a report released on Saturday. Finance Minister Nirmala Sitaraman released the report which ranks state based on 180 reform points covering 12 business regulatory areas such as access to information, single window system, labour, environment among others.

Gujarat was among the top ten states while West Bengal was ahead at the ninth spot. Jharkhand and Chattisgarh took the fifth and sixth places while Madhya Pradesh was placed at number four. Delhi bagged the top spot among the Union Territories. Assam was among the top performers among the North Eastern states. The industrially important state of Maharashtra was ranked 13th in the list for 2019, retaining the same spot for the second successive year. Uttar Pradesh has made strong comeback rising to the second position in 2019 from 12th place I 2018.

Himachal Pradesh moved upto the seventh place in 2019 from 16th in 2018. In the overall, ranking, Delhi moved to the 12th spot in 2019 from the 23rd place in 2018. The rankings for 2019 were to be released in March this year but had to be postponed due to the Covid- 19 pandemic. The Government had launched the ease of doing ranking for states to trigger a competition among states to reform their business and approval processes to attract investment. The sustained progress of India’s ranking in the World Bank’s ease of doing business had also had an impact on states to shore up their approval and regulatory processes and increase their potential to attract investors.

India is seen taking the reform process seriously which showed when Foreign Direct Investment in the country increased even during the Covid- 19 pandemic, amid what was called the World’s strictest lock down, said Finance Minister Nirmala Sitarama while releasing the rankings.
